site stats

Sm9 bouncycastle

Webb20 jan. 2024 · BouncyCastle是一个提供了很多哈希算法和加密算法的第三方库。它提供了Java标准库没有的一些算法,例如,RipeMD160哈希算法。其它第三方库还 … Webb17 juni 2024 · SM2算法由国家密码管理局于2010年12月17日发布,是我国自主设计的公钥密码算法,基于更加安全先进的椭圆曲线密码机制,在国际标准的ECC椭圆曲线密码理论基础上进行自主研发设计,具备ECC算法的性能特点并实现优化改进。 SM2算法和RSA算法性能对比 SM2算法和RSA算法都属于公钥加密算法,但两者分别基于不同的数学理论基础 …

国密SM9算法C++实现(Linux)

Webb国密SM9算法C++实现(Linux) 首先参考 Linux下编译并使用miracl密码库 该博文在linux下编译Miracl库. 编译完了,自然是要用的,下面介绍两种在C程序中使用miracl库的方法. 方法一: 1. 源码编译完后的必需的文件是两个头文件miracl.h和mirdef.h以及编译后的静态函数库miracl.a,需要在自己写的C程序中使用. 2. 输入如下代码,命名为main.c mkdir miracl-test … Webb29 maj 2024 · BouncyCastle的SM实践 一、按照pdf配置环境 配置好后代码大致结构如图所示: 二、SM2 按照PDF实践即可,效果如上图所示 需要小改以下demo文件 package … city breaks with a toddler https://pushcartsunlimited.com

使用Bouncy Castle(pom版本:bcprov-jdk15on 1.59)中SM4 加 …

http://www.gmbz.org.cn/main/bzlb.html Webb8 feb. 2024 · SM4 分组密码算法,是由国家密码局发布的国产商用密码算法。 该算法的分组长度为128 bit,密钥长度为128 bit。 具体算法描述可以查阅 GB/T 32907-2016 《信息安全技术 SM4分组密码算法》 。 本文 SM4 的java实现方法,在BC库( bouncycastle )的基础上做了简单的封装,JS方法在 sm-crypto 的基础上做的封装。 JAVA 加解密方法 … Webb5 aug. 2024 · 「SM9」シリーズの基本となるグラインド。 シリーズ中、ソールが最も平らで、ソール全面でバンスの効果を発揮してくれます。 さまざまなライやスイングタイプに対応するグラインドです。 「Fグラインド」 トゥ、ヒール、リーディングエッジ、トレーリングエッジはほとんど削られておらず、平面的な形状。 どんなライでも、どんな … city breaks vienna 2023

GitHub - zweib730/SM9-misc: 国密SM2/SM9算法测试数据

Category:GmSSL

Tags:Sm9 bouncycastle

Sm9 bouncycastle

国密 SM2,SM2Engine类加密后,前面多了一个字节 0x04 - 简书

Webb代码中实现了电码本ECB模式和密文分组连接CBC模式,SM3.java和SM4.java为算法实现类,utils的都是根据实现类写的工具,可以根据需要调用杂凑算法SM3的杂凑功能获得杂凑值。SM4.java中sm4_crypt_ecb(SM4_Context ctx, byte[] input) ECB模式加解密方法,根据密钥判断加解密功能sm4_crypt_cbc(SM4_Contex... http://www.bouncycastle.org/java.html

Sm9 bouncycastle

Did you know?

Webb30 juli 2024 · 1、简述 BouncyCastle (轻量级密码术包)是一种用于 Java 平台的开放源码的轻量级密码术包; Bounc ycstle 包含了大量的密码算法,其支持椭圆曲线密码算法, … WebbThe Bouncy Castle Crypto APIs for Java consist of the following: A lightweight cryptography API. A provider for the Java Cryptography Extension (JCE) and the Java …

Webb30 dec. 2024 · Contribute to zweib730/SM9-misc development by creating an account on GitHub. 国密SM2/SM9算法测试数据. Contribute to zweib730/SM9-misc development by … Webb6 feb. 2010 · The Bouncy Castle APIs currently consist of the following: A lightweight cryptography API for Java and C#. A provider for the Java Cryptography Extension (JCE) … Welcome. Welcome to the home of the Legion of the Bouncy Castle Java … Home of the Legion of the Bouncy Castle and their Java cryptography resources … About - bouncycastle.org If you are trying to work out the ordering, the list is alphabetical. If you would like to be … So please contact us [email protected] about support … Latest Java Releases BC-FJA 1.0.2.4 - Non Certified FIPS Release Candidate … Java FIPS Resources. Welcome to the resources page for the Java FIPS project. … C# .NET FIPS Resources. Welcome to the resources page for the C# .NET FIPS …

WebbVokey Design SM9 Enastående Hantverk och Teknik Bra wedge-spel handlar om att slå många olika typer av slag och ha kontroll på både längd och spinn. SM9-wedgarnas material och struktur representerar vår mest tekniskt avancerade konstruktion för alla tre faktorer, finjusterad för ren bollträff, lägre bollflykt och mer spinn. Nytt för 2024 WebbSM3算法:SM3杂凑算法是我国自主设计的密码杂凑算法,适用于商用密码应用中的数字签名和验证消息认证码的生成与验证以及随机数的生成,可满足多种密码应用的安全需求。 为了保证杂凑算法的安全性,其产生的杂凑值的长度不应太短,例如MD5输出128比特杂凑值,输出长度太短,影响其安全性SHA-1算法的输出长度为160比特,SM3算法的输出长度 …

Webb15 apr. 2024 · C#国密加密算法SM9一个实现案例代码。含加密和签名(密钥协商暂无)。 说明如下: 1、BouncyCastle.Crypto:工程需要引用的原始库(不会引用直接百度即可); 2、sm9.cs:SM9算法主体内容。 另:为了提高可读性及...

WebbGmSSL city breaks veniceWebb24 nov. 2024 · c#国密加密算法sm9一个实现案例代码。 含加密和签名(密钥协商暂无)。 说明如下: 1、BouncyCastle.Crypto:工程需要引用的原始库(不会引用直接百度即 … dick\\u0027s sporting goods circularWebb10 apr. 2024 · BouncyCastle.Crypto:一个流行的加密类库,支持SM2、SM3和SM4算法。 2. GMccrypto:适用于.NET Framework 4.0及更高版本的一组国密算法实现,包括SM2、SM3、SM4等。 3. GmSSL:由国密标准化工作组开发的一组C语言实现的密码学库,可以通过P/Invoke方式在C#中使用。 4. OpenSSL:一个流行的加密类库,支持国密算法,可以 … city breaks with kidsWebb前端通sm2Encrypt加密完成后,现在的password就是一大串字符 。. 然后这时候给后端,提交过程中就算你获取到了你也解不开,因为你没有私钥~~~. 后端呢,获取到了一大串字符的password之后,就开始进行解密(还是借鉴来的代码(稍作更改)):. String cipherData = "从 ... city breaks with kids in europecity breaks with beachesWebbBouncy Castle nació como resultado del esfuerzo de dos colegas que sufrieron la necesidad de recrear librerías criptográficas en cada cambio de empleo. Un requisito de diseño inicial fue que existieran versiones de la librería para el entorno JavaME por lo que existen 2 juegos de librerías. Arquitectura [ editar] dick\u0027s sporting goods cincinnati ohioWebbimport lombok.extern.slf4j.Slf4j; import org.bouncycastle.crypto.digests.SM3Digest; import org.bouncycastle.crypto.macs.HMac; import … dick\\u0027s sporting goods citrus park